The Cabka Group is a group of companies founded in 1993 with a focus on recycling and plastics processing based in Berlin . Cabka has developed from a recycling company to a global group of companies in the field of processing household and industrial waste into value-adding end products. These include, among other things, pallets and boxes as well as floor fixings. The company's products are used in around 80 countries in the chemical and pharmaceutical industries, in retail , the food and beverage industry and the automotive industry.

The group consists of the umbrella company Cabka Group and its subsidiaries . In 2015, it generated a total output of around 139 million euros. Cabka has production sites in Germany, Spain, Belgium and the USA with a total of 700 employees. Key positions (CFO Group, COO Group) were filled in the 2016 financial year.

history

Today's Cabka company was founded in 1993 by Gat Ramon. In the following years he developed technologies for processing difficult mixed plastics in Weira near Jena , at that time still under the name Recover Systems .

In 1998 the company took over Cabka Plast, established in 1977, and changed the name of the entire group to Cabka.

Due to the strong demand for plastic pallets , Cabka started producing in the USA from 2005 and opened its own recycling and production facilities in St. Louis , Missouri , a little later . In the course of internationalization, the company has also been manufacturing in Spain since 2009 and operates its own sales office and warehouse there. In 2012 Cabka and the Belgian company Innova Packaging Systems NV (IPS), founded in 1988, merged under the umbrella of the newly established Cabka Group. Since then, the new Cabka-IPS brand has been offering plastic pallets under the management of Gat Ramon as managing partner. In the years that followed, the group bought other companies - including Eryplast , KS Kunststofftechnik GmbH & Co. and Systec Mixed Plastics GmbH (SMP) Genthin . SMP was previously part of Duales System Holding , which operates the Der Grüne Punkt brand .

Company profile

Business lines

Cabka is made up of the Material Handling (MH) and EcoProducts business divisions.

Cabka-IPS material handling

Cabka MH products are available in different material qualities. The spectrum ranges from inexpensive, recycled PO plastic to new food-safe HDPE . The company's goal is to produce logistics solutions primarily from recycled plastics.

Cabka EcoProducts

Cabka EcoProducts are technical products that are made from 100 percent recycled plastic - mainly from household packaging waste . These product lines are primarily used in gardening and landscaping (GALA) as well as in construction and transport and include:

  • Flexible lawn grids
  • Palisade with fuller
  • Mobile site fence supports
  • Inflow base for biofilter systems
  • Flexible speed thresholds

Business overview

The Cabka Group, with its two business divisions Material Handling and EcoProducts, serves two independent product areas. Both of them focus on manufacturing new products from recycled plastics. These come from production committees in industry, from household packaging waste and from the return of disused products. The aim is to keep these recyclable materials in a closed cycle through close cooperation with customers.

To extract the material, the raw materials are processed in the company's own recycling facilities in a dry, mechanical process after sorting, without dissolving them chemically or thermally. The raw materials obtained are used in product development according to their material properties and then mixed together. In principle, every product and every customer-specific solution can be manufactured from a specially developed material mixture. Within this field, Cabka specializes in mixed plastics and composites that are difficult to separate .

With material extraction, product development and manufacturing, Cabka combines three production stages under one roof. In this strongly vertically integrated value chain , the company is a supplier, service provider and manufacturer in one.

Locations

Cabka has production sites in Weira , Genthin and Bad Münstereifel (Germany), Ypres and Herstal (Belgium) as well as in Valencia (Spain) and St. Louis (USA). The Cabka Group has had its headquarters in Berlin since 2012 .
